An Excellent pair of verses, composed on the pious life and death of the late venerable and pious Mrs. Sarah Thayer : the virtuous consort of the late eminent Mr. Ephraim Thayer, of Braintree, who departed this transitory state, Aug. 19, 1751 ... (Now re-published at the earnest request and for the benefit of her numerous relations, friends and acquaintance, with a view of perpetuating the memory of so worthy a character.).

Item Description:Verse in twenty-six numbered stanzas; first line: Good people all I pray attend.
Parentheses substituted for square brackets in title transcription.
Text in three columns, with double rows of border ornaments, enclosing Bible verses, separating columns; printed area measures 29.9 x 25.2 cm.
